Disability shower installation services involve modifying or constructing shower areas to accommodate individuals with mobility challenges or disabilities. These services typically include the installation of accessible features such as low-threshold or curbless entryways, grab bars, seating options, and non-slip flooring. The goal is to create a safe, functional, and comfortable shower environment that meets the specific needs of users with limited mobility or other physical limitations. Professionals working on these installations ensure that the fixtures and design elements adhere to accessibility standards, providing a practical solution for enhanced independence and safety.
These services address common problems faced by individuals with disabilities or mobility issues when using traditional showers. Standard shower setups often pose barriers such as high thresholds, slippery surfaces, or lack of support features, increasing the risk of slips, falls, and injuries. Disability shower installation helps eliminate these hazards by creating barrier-free access and incorporating safety features that support stability and ease of use. This can be especially beneficial for seniors, those recovering from surgery, or individuals with chronic conditions that affect mobility, enabling them to maintain personal hygiene with greater independence.

Installation Costs - The cost for installing a disability shower typically ranges from $1,500 to $4,000, depending on the complexity and materials used. Basic models may be on the lower end, while customized features can increase the price. Local pros can provide detailed estimates based on specific needs.
Material Expenses - Materials for disability showers can vary from $500 to $2,500, with options including accessible tiles, grab bars, and low-threshold bases. Higher-end finishes and durable, slip-resistant surfaces tend to increase overall costs. Contact service providers for material recommendations and pricing.
Additional Features - Adding features like seating, hand-held shower heads, or specialized fixtures can add $200 to $1,000 to the total cost. The inclusion of these features depends on individual accessibility requirements and preferences. Local contractors can advise on suitable options and pricing.
Labor and Permits - Labor costs for installing a disability shower generally range from $800 to $2,000, varying by project scope and local rates. Permitting fees, if required, can add to the overall expense, with costs depending on local regulations. Service providers can offer precise quotes after assessing the site.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.
